Martial confirms Manchester United departure after 9 years

French striker Anthony Martial confirmed on Monday that he will leave Manchester United after nine years.

“It is with great emotion that I write to you today to say goodbye. After nine incredible years at the club, the time has come to turn a new page in my career,” Martial said in a statement on Instagram.

The 28-year-old joined the Premier League club in a £36 million ($45.9 million) move from Monaco in September 2015 but has not lived up to expectations. He has not played a senior game since December after undergoing groin surgery.

During his time in England, Martial won the FA Cup, League Cup, Europa League, but neither the Premier League nor the Champions League. He played 317 matches and scored 90 goals in all competitions.

“Manchester United will always be in my heart. This club has left its mark on my career and given me an incredible opportunity to play in front of you,” continued Martial, who has a 2022 loan spell at Seville.

“I am leaving to accept new challenges, I will always be a Red Devil and I will continue to follow the club’s results with passion.”

Martial’s contract expires this summer.
